# Ax Signatures For C++

This skill helps an agent write C++ code with the generated Ax package `axllm`. Use the generated package API, examples, and manifests; do not import TypeScript-only APIs unless you are editing the TypeScript package.

## When To Use

- Declare input and output contracts with native generated-package APIs.
- Generate JSON-schema-compatible shapes for outputs, tools, prompts, and validation.
- Keep Standard Schema and TypeScript-only helper libraries out of generated-language code.

## Core Pattern

```cpp
#include "axllm/axllm.hpp"

auto sig = axllm::s("question:string -> answer:string");
auto schema = axllm::to_json_schema(axllm::Core::get(sig, "outputs"));
```

## Guardrails

- Start from package examples for exact native syntax before inventing a new call shape.
- Use `provider-api` examples only when the user explicitly has provider credentials available.
- Use `no-key` examples for deterministic local checks and provider request mapping.
- Treat AxIR as the source of generated package truth: if package docs disagree with source code, update the compiler and regenerate packages.
- Do not copy repo-maintainer skills from `tools/*/skills/` into user packages.
